Lead.NET Developer
We're looking for an experienced Lead.NET Developer to join our growing technology team. You'll lead the design, development, and delivery of scalable software solutions, provide technical guidance to developers, and help drive engineering best practices across the business.
Working closely with Product, DevOps, QA, Support, and Project teams, you'll play a key role in delivering high-quality applications while mentoring team members and contributing to technical strategy.
Skills & Experience
- 8+ years' software development experience
- Strong experience with C#, ASP.NET, .NET Core/.NET
- Experience with Azure, Microservices, Event-Driven Architecture
- Knowledge of SQL Server, REST APIs, MVC, Web APIs
- Experience with Docker, gRPC, Azure Service Bus
- Proficient with Git and modern development practices
- Strong stakeholder management and communication skills
- Previous experience leading or mentoring developers
